Transaction eced8390527fa9b3c91f54d3d8d58590e8cbc3057cca5d91accc1a5b6ca20c87
1 Input
1 Output
-
eced8390527fa9b3c91f54d3d8d58590e8cbc3057cca5d91accc1a5b6ca20c87:0
- value
- 30736779
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bbbbb30776a0d75ed148103bed65edb49bb9826
- address
- bc1qhwamkvrhdgxhtmg5sypma4j7mdymhxpxuwukm5